What Is Full Grooming for Dogs? A Complete Guide for Pet Owners

Full grooming for dogs is a complete care service that usually includes bathing, brushing, drying, hair trimming or clipping, nail trimming, ear cleaning, and sanitary-area grooming. It helps keep a dog’s coat clean, comfortable, healthy, and manageable while allowing groomers to identify possible skin, coat, ear, or nail concerns. Dog

How to Trim a Dog’s Nails: Beginner-Friendly Guide

To trim a dog’s nails safely, use pet nail clippers and cut small portions of the nail while avoiding the quick, which contains blood vessels and nerves. Regular nail trimming helps prevent pain, improve mobility, and support overall paw health. If you’re unsure or your dog is anxious, professional grooming
